PoArtMo stands for “Positive Actions Rally Thoughts & Momentum,” a concept based on the following tenets: 1. Family-friendliness & clean language – 2. Positivity and upliftment – 3. Inclusivity and respect for all.

Inspired by NaNoWriMo (National Novel Writing Month) and NaPoWriMo (National Poetry Writing Month), PoArtMo seeks to promote positive and inspirational art and creativity.

Every year, Cendrine Marrouat, David Ellis, and Azelle Elric work together to release a volume of the PoArtMo Anthology. They also welcome participation from inspirational creatives.

Submission deadline for Volume 5: March 31, 2024

Ages: 17 and over.

Language: English only.

Topic / Theme: We will consider every topic, except for erotica and politics. No swear words allowed.

Your work must contain an inspirational / uplifting message and be family-friendly. We recommend purchasing a copy of one of our volumes to get familiar with the kind of work we accept.

What we accept: Short stories, flash fiction, essays, drawings, paintings, poetry, photography, and digital art. 

Number of pieces per participant: at least 5 – up to a maximum of 10.

Payment to selected contributors: PDF copy of anthology + ongoing royalties (1% per published piece).

Fee: $0. But a donation of at least $10 is required if you want a PDF copy of the anthology and ongoing royalties.

Please note the following:

  • Previously published work is acceptable, but we would much prefer receiving original content for our anthology. However, we have a zero-tolerance policy for simultaneous submissions.
  • NO AI-GENERATED ART!
  • Images that are under 300 ppi in resolution and 1,500 pixels on the longer side will automatically be rejected. Images must also be sent to as separate files.
  • Any unprofessional behaviors, threats and false accusations levelled against us will be addressed in the following manner: automatic rejection of your submission, no fee refund, and indefinite ban from submitting to us.
  • While we understand that mistakes happen, it is your responsibility to read and follow our guidelines. We will no longer contact artists who have incorrectly submitted to us to give them a second chance.
  • Have your work proofread / edited before you send it to us. If we accept it but find too many issues during the editing phase, we will send it back to you for corrections or charge you an hourly fee if you prefer us to proofread it for you.
